Welcome to the Tarivo platform team. Your first ticket touches the tax-rate lookup cache in the ratesvc module. The cache pulls jurisdiction tables from the Quillmark rates API every six hours and stores them in Redis under the `taxrate:` prefix. Never bypass the cache in production; the upstream API is rate-limited. Copy `env.sample` to `.env.local`, set `TAXCACHE_TTL=21600`, and confirm Redis connectivity with `make cache-ping`. Then add the following line to authenticate against the rates API:

vault entry, yahif-yajep: COURIER_KEY29=b802bdf8034096b65a51c6ba5abe2

- [ ] **Step 7: Breaker override escrow.** After sealing the signing keys for the Tallgrove upstream API circuit breaker, confirm the support team can force the breaker open during a full outage. The override bundle lives in the sealed escrow drawer and is useless without its unlock phrase. Two ceremony witnesses must initial this step before proceeding. The escrow bundle is decrypted with the recovery passphrase that follows.

vault phrase of kahip-kahop = holath-quenmir

# --- Harvestlink Telemetry Gateway: settings ---
# On-call notes. Gateway ingests CAN-bus frames from Ploughman tractors
# and combine units, batches every 30s, writes to the telemetry store.
# If ingestion stalls: check the decoder pool first, then broker lag.
# Do NOT raise batch size above 500; the write path will back up.
# Restart order: decoder, then writer, never both at once.
# The writer persists to the database reachable via the following.

replica DSN, kajep-yahag: mssql://praok_svc:iF@db-8d68.plorvaio.local:5432/eliion

## Configuration

PedalShift needs a few knobs set before it can start rebalancing docks across the Varnmouth network. Most defaults in `config/defaults.toml` are fine to ship as-is — truck capacity, rebalance window, the usual. The one thing you can't skip is the dispatch API credential, since the optimizer won't even boot without it. Open the `.env` file in the deploy root and add the following line:

sealed setting: ARCHIVE_KEY3=8d0